This print showcases a German woodcut portrait of Suleiman I, the influential Sultan of the Ottoman Empire from 1520 to 1566. Created in 1548 by Michael Ostendorfer, this artwork beautifully captures the essence of Suleiman's reign and persona. In this stunning depiction, Suleiman stands tall with an air of authority and confidence. His regal attire reflects his status as a powerful leader, adorned with a majestic turban and traditional Turkish clothing. The intricate details in the woodcut bring out every aspect of his appearance, from his mid-length beard to his distinguished moustache. The scepter held firmly in Suleiman's hand symbolizes his firm grip on power and sovereignty over the vast Ottoman Empire. As one of history's most notable Muslim rulers, he left an indelible mark on both Islamic culture and world politics during the Renaissance era. This remarkable woodcut not only serves as a visual representation but also offers insight into the artistic style prevalent in Germany at that time. The use of typeface adds another layer to its historical significance.
